The Pussycat Dolls

Founded in Los Angeles in the mid‑1990s, The Pussycat Dolls began as a burlesque troupe conceived by choreographer Robin Antin before evolving in the early 2000s into a pop and R&B group aimed at studio work and live performance. Around lead singer Nicole Scherzinger a female lineup took shape, combining singing with tightly choreographed dance and giving The Pussycat Dolls a strongly theatrical identity. Signed to Interscope, the group adopted a dance‑pop and R&B sound mixing urban textures, catchy choruses and hip‑hop influences, with significant emphasis on vocal harmonies and club‑oriented arrangements. The first album, PCD, was released in 2005, followed by Doll Domination in 2008 — two milestones that cemented the project’s aesthetic between mid‑tempo songs and more electronic tracks designed for radio and large venues. The Pussycat Dolls occasionally collaborated with producers and rappers from the pop and hip‑hop scenes and became fixtures on television, at festivals and on international tours. After an extended hiatus in the early 2010s, the group announced a reunion in 2019, marked by a new single in 2020 and a series of media appearances focused on reworking their stage repertoire.
